National Conference vice president Omar Abdullah on Wednesday said the NC-Congress government will pass a resolution demanding the restoration of Jammu and Kashmir's statehood in its first cabinet meeting. "After the formation of the government, I hope in the first cabinet meeting, the cabinet will pass a resolution impressing upon the Centre to restore the statehood. The government should then take that resolution to the prime minister," Abdullah told reporters here. He expressed hope that the government in Jammu and Kashmir will be able to run smoothly unlike in Delhi. "There is a difference between us and Delhi. Delhi was never a state. No one promised Delhi a statehood. Jammu and Kashmir was a state before 2019. We have been promised the restoration of statehood by the prime minister, the home minister and other senior ministers who have said that three steps will be taken in J-K -? delimitation, election and then statehood.
